Information on 9TH Gear Operation – 2018-2023 Buick Cadillac Chevrolet GMC

Chevrolet Buick GMC Cadillac

NHTSA ID Number: 10219391 Manufacturer Communication Number: 21-NA-181 Summary This service bulletin provides 9th gear operation information to respond to customers that may comment on transmission shift operation.   Condition Some customers may comment that the transmission doesn’t shift into 9th gear or maintain 9th gear operation to customer expectations.   Information The GM 9-speed transmission does … Read more

Drivers Side Object Sensing Alert Module Not Working Correctly and/or Incorrect Side Mirror Notification – 2018-2023 Chevrolet Equinox & GMC Terrain, 2018-2020 Holden Equinox

2023 Chevrolet Equinox

NHTSA ID Number: 10219264 Manufacturer Communication Number: 18-NA-176 Summary This technical bulletin provides a procedure to add reflective butyl tape to the rear drivers side module to correct the radar reflection being detected and triggering the false alerts.   Condition Some customers may comment when driving, the side mirror indicates there is a vehicle present when there … Read more

Poor Engine Performance in Extremely Cold Weather Conditions, PCV Bypass Hose and Charge Air Cooler Icing for LUV Engines, Malfunction Indicator Lamp (MIL) Illuminated – DTC P0299, P0234, P2227, P00C7 Set – 2013-2021 Buick Encore & Chevrolet Trax

Chevrolet Buick

NHTSA ID Number: 10222825 Manufacturer Communication Number: 16-NA-405 Summary This service bulletin provides a procedure to install a PCV heater or a charge air cooler to correct the turbo charger system from freezing causing cold weather performance issues.   Condition Some customers may comment that when driving in extremely cold weather conditions (-18°C or less / 0°F … Read more
